Every other economics school has its own distinct culture and strengths. We've pulled together some statistics and other details to help you see how the other economics program at Central Washington University stacks up to those at other schools.

CWU is located in Ellensburg, Washington and has a total student population of 11,174. Of the 739 students who graduated with a bachelor’s degree from Central Washington University in 2021, 9 of them were other economics majors.

During the 2020-2021 academic year, 9 students graduated with a bachelor's degree in other economics from CWU. About 67% were men and 33% were women.

undefined

About 78% of those who receive a bachelor's degree in other economics at CWU are white. This is above average for this degree on the nationwide level. Prospective students may be interested in knowing that this school graduates 3% more racial-ethnic minorities in its other economics bachelor's program than the national average.*
